String bir refrence değişken tipidir ve bu nedenle çeşitli methodlara erişebilir.
String name = "Can";
name.equals("Can");
Burada Equals methodu bir “Boolean” sonuc döndürür.
boolean result = name.equals("Can");
Veya case ignore ile
boolean result = name.equalsIgnoreCase("Can");
Kac karakter kontrol etmek icin
int uzunluk = name.length();
Mesela “a” harfini almak icin
char karakter = name.charAt(1);
Su karakter nerede ?
int nerde = name.indexOf("a");
String degiskeni dolu mu bos mu
boolean dolumu = name.isEmpty();
Tum harfleri buyut (yada kucult)
String buyut = name.toUpperCase();
Tüm bosluklari al
String bosluksuz = name.trim();
karakter degistir. (a –> o olacak)
String degistir = name.replace("a", "o");